How can I speed up the process of entering all of the books in our library?
ResourceMate® Plus, Extended or Premium: One of the features of these more advanced versions of ResourceMate® allows several people to enter items into their home computers, transfer to the main computer, and merge those items into the main computer. This feature allows volunteers or committee members to help in the process of entering the entire library.
Enter Basic Information: When entering items into ResourceMate® it is not necessary to enter all information related to that item. The person entering can determine how much or how little information they want to enter. Some people begin by entering the title, author, category and Dewey decimal call number of all items in their library and later come back to enter replacement value and detailed subject information. Include the isbn and later on you can retrieve more bibliographic information by using the isbn retrieval feature (available to registered users with up to date support).
ISBN Retrieval / Batch ISBN: This feature allows you to find full cataloguing information using the free Library of Congress Z39.50 web site. This very popular feature can increase your entry speed by about five times.
With ISBN Retrieval, type in the ISBN, click the ISBN Retrieval button and, if you have an internet connection, the information is automatically retrieved from the Library of Congress. ISBN Retrieval is available to registered users with paid support.
Batch ISBN - Process your list of 10, 100 or 1,000 isbns instead of one at a time (available in the Plus, Extended and Premium version).

How extensive are the search capabilities of ResourceMate®?
On the Simple Search Screen you can search by Title, Author, Subject or Keyword. You may also define 4 more buttons to search any field. A convenient feature of this screen is that, an entered title will search the title, sub-title and series fields simultaneously. An entered author will search the author, second author, third author and Statement of Responsibility fields.
On the Complex Search Screen you can search by any field. Boolean (and, or, not) searching is also available.
When generating any of the item reports, you may include/exclude specific items based on ANY of the information that has been entered including notes and comments and user defined fields. Complex compound or “chained” queries allow you to find, for example, all books not checked out in the last two years, etc.

What about e-Books / e-resources?
We now have an eBook Patron Validation
add on. Don't re-enter patron credentials on your ebook providers site. With this add on in place, your ebook provider can validate your patron bar code (or username) and optional pin that the patron enters.
ResourceMate® has always had a web field on the main tab where you can enter an internet url related to the cataloged item. This can be used for e-resources that you want to make available to your patrons. When they search using the OPAC they can double click the link and launch a browser to that location.
Your web opac can also show the link if you export the web site field.
Most e-Book suppliers should supply MARC records which the Plus, Extended and Premium versions of ResourceMate® can import into your existing database. Those MARC records should include an 856 record which will import into the web field in ResourceMate®.
If authentication is not embedded in the 856u tag of the MARC record (the information that will go into the web site field), authentication can be achieved by contacting your e-provider or Jaywil Software.
Authentication is the process of patrons automatically logging into the e-book provider when they click through on either your OPAC or Web OPAC.

What about 13 digit ISBN numbers?
The following pertains to ISBN retrieval and creation of an ISBN file for Batch ISBN (Plus, Extended and Premium) processing. The ISBN field in ResourceMate will hold fifteen numbers/characters. You can enter anything you want into the ISBN field.
For the purposes of ISBN retrieval and creation of an ISBN file for Batch ISBN processing, you can enter either the 10 digit isbn or the 13 digit isbn. Most services available through ISBN Retrieval will search either the 10 digit or the 13 digit isbn.
What is the capacity of the call number fields?
There are 5 call number fields, each allowing for 15 characters or numbers. There is a Section field above the call number fields. This is used for headings such as JF (Junior Fiction), TF (Teen Fiction), BIO (Biography), LP (Large Print), etc.

How does this service work?
Once you connect to the service, you are prompted to download a small, self-installing plug-in, which allows your support representative to view your desktop and share control of your mouse and keyboard. At any time during a support session, you can take control of your computer just by moving your mouse. You will be in charge at all times.
Can my support representative look through files without my knowledge?
Absolutely not. Your representative sees only what you see and whatever you permit him or her to see on your computer screen. Before your support representative views your screen, he or she will first ask your permission and request that you close all documents containing private information.
How is security maintained?
At the beginning of a screen-sharing session, you and your support representative are connected via a communication server. The screen data that is passed between you and your support representative during a session is highly compressed using proprietary technology that can be viewed only with GoToAssist software. This data is also encrypted using 128-bit Advanced Encryption Standard (AES) encryption. Privacy principles are TRUSTe compliant. After the session has ended, your support representative can no longer see your screen or access your computer unless you make another explicit request for support.

Are there any files or folders left on my computer after the session ends?
The downloaded file stays on your computer; however, the file is useless without a new "encryption key." To download a new encryption key, you would need to initiate a subsequent session with a support representative. Screen-sharing sessions have to be initiated by you, not a support representative.
